In a heartwarming tale of community support and unexpected kindness, a misdialed phone call has brought to light the struggles of a disabled man in Tallahassee, Florida. Benson Devane, a 65-year-old resident, found himself in a dire situation when his power was cut off due to a leaning utility pole on his property. This incident, while seemingly mundane, has sparked a wave of compassion and highlighted the importance of community support systems.

What makes this story particularly fascinating is the chain of events that led to Devane's lifeline. In his moment of need, he reached out to what he thought was the Federal Emergency Management Agency (FEMA), only to find himself connected to Grace Georgi of FINA Consulting. Her kindness and willingness to help, sparked by a simple voicemail, have become the focal point of this narrative. The fact that a wrong number led to an 'angel' in the form of Georgi, underscores the power of human connection and the potential for positive change.

A detail that I find especially interesting is the role of local officials and community organizations in this story. The City of Tallahassee's Chief Operating Officer, James Barnes, and Commissioner Jeremy Matlow, played a crucial role in restoring Devane's power. Their actions not only helped Devane, but also served as a model for how communities can come together to support one another. The fact that Barnes and Matlow were able to expedite the process and provide additional resources underscores the importance of local leadership and community engagement.
